Seika used the alleys to her advantage. She noticed that the building next to her was an abandoned storage facility and cut through the rows of storage units. She decided what she really needed to do was change the game plan for them. They were prepared for her here on the surface, but she was willing to bet they were not as ready for chasing her into the sewers of the city. It was high risk to try and use the sewers to hide and travel. If they figured it out early enough they could cut her off from both sides and she'd be forced to attack people directly which she did not want to do. But she needed to try something, so she moved out from the storage units onto the street and looked for the opening to the sewer she needed.

The sewers were dark and quiet. Seika made her way by the light of her own barrier on her forehead and the lights to the outside from other storm drains along the way. She held out one gauntlet and made a bright square barrier around it to light her way better and began to sprint down the sewers, her feet splashing in the water from a storm that must have been recent. If she wasn't spotted by the army going in here she could follow the path for quite a while but she couldn't take that chance of getting cut off so her plan was only to follow it for a few minutes which at her speed was still quite the distance. If they didn't catch her dipping into here she could be outside their expected search zone, but even then she would have to be careful of spotters.

Things did not go as planned down in that dank sewer, but it wasn't her current enemy that made her pause. As she pushed along the featureless space she felt an all too familiar presence at this inopportune time. Seika felt that a witch was born just now somewhere on the surface off of the path of her underground route. Despite everything that was going on, Seika still felt a need to go after this witch. The fight was something she believed in even if Kyuubey was behind it. There was some logic to his plan to fight the heat death of the universe and stopping witches could save the innocent which behind Seika's logical exterior spoke to her idealistic heart, though she knew how foolhardy it was to trust idealism. She could also use the grief seed as her stockpile was dangerously low from the fighting and avoiding the military. She always come up with some kind of excuse to do the good thing her heart wanted, often without even realizing it. It was also a plus that the mundane people could not sense the witch's labyrinth. While normal people and their guns could manage to deal with a magical girl, they had a weakness to exploit. The witch inside did not and her familiars are usually numerous and unrelenting. Some witches would be easier than others but many could attack huge areas and wipe out armies when a magical girl could take that kind of attack or dodge it.

So, Seika started moving towards the feeling of the witch. This was still an unanswered question though, how did a witch form in a city with no magical girls? Seika knew that they were normally formed out of magical girls falling into despair or familiars escaped from other witches after eating a bunch of people. They would even eventually reform if a grief seed was used and then discarded. Normally they were given to Kyuubey who ate the seed. Perhaps there was a simpler answer that one of the magical girls that was here before had stashed her unused grief seeds and they had come from that.Since the start of being a magical girl though there always seemed like there was an abundance of them appearing in random locations and while lost familiars did turn into witches, she had seen it once before, Seika herself has never fought the same witch twice. There was no more time to think of this now as she jumped up through one of the storm drains to exit onto the streets. She landed and quickly jumped forward multiple times before going to running again. Fortunately so far her plan to avoid the army seemed to be working so she probably cleared past the area they were currently looking for her in and it takes time to clear a wide area.

Ahead she could see the shimmer of a hidden labyrinth, so she slowed to a stop at the entrance. if she burst in Seika could easily attract unwanted attention from the witch and bring the familiars running right to her to start fighting depending on the nature of the witch. Some witches and their familiars were not even hostile until provoked but there was no way to tell until you walked up to them and then they could be triggered by some otherwise innocuous action.She put one hand up to the shimmer and a magical circle appeared at her hand on the labyrinth. With this she could carefully slip into the labyrinth, it was a trick any experienced magical girl could learn eventually just like healing. So she focused and the black circle shifted to the color blue and then into a blue portal inside. Seika stepped forward and then everything faded away and turned to white.

Elsewhere, the Dean of Evil Acadamey was preparing to head out. After his defeat at the hands of three troublesome primes he was hunting in the Tangled Greens, he had sped himself back to his base of operations. Fortunately this was an easy task as he pulled out his recall pad and in a burst of light he re-appeared at the teleportation pad in his hidden secret base in the Pale Moors. He had his minions heal his wounds with healing magic and then rested for the night while he contemplated his new situation. In the morning he ordered his ninjas to regroup and prepare to move out. Meanwhile he checked in on his experiments. The Hollows he had used were too weak to be worth anything. It was time to step it up a notch despite the risks. "You, get some of the Prinnies and throw them into the Hollowization room! Maybe human souls we know are full of evil will work better than animal-men." The wood Golem that was standing there nodded. "Yes Master Mao." "And make sure the Hollows don't escape! I'm going out again." "Yes Master Mao." It would be just his luck if the new Hollows created this way broke through and ransacked the place, but some of his best minions were always here on guard duty.

Mao made his way out of his base and out into the dark and mysterious Pale Moors. He had a well hidden base, especially as he was not on any terms with the local overlord Dracula. The entrance to his base behind him was protected by a patch of particularly think brush that was a very common feature in the untamed wetlands. As a Prime he could easily touch up the outside where even the best cleanup crew would leave traces of unusual activity if you knew what to look for. Omnillium allowed him to get almost any component he wanted and this also allowed him to reconstruct the landscape as if it was brand new and by breaking down and rebuilding it he didn't need to spend any precious OM in the process. He also didn't need logstical support by making deals with the locals for food and supplies as he could use omnilium to summon in any amount he desired though at times this was an annoyance. Sometimes it felt like he was more of a vending machine supplying food to his minions when they should be doing the work for him but only Primes could manipulate Omnilium.

Mao's three remaining ninja appeared suddenly in puffs of smoke next to him. "Let's get going, I want to track down those two demon girls we met in the forest again. Their blogs should make this easy for us so I won't take failure this time! I'm going up front this time to make sure the job gets done right." The ninjas nodded obediantly, demon ninjas were particularly well known for their loyalty to their master. When Mao got to the Omniverse, he knew he had to get some of them as henchmen as the could usually be trusted with the more secretive tasks. They would sooner kill themselves than betray their master. That delinquent Raspberyl had shown Mao just how useful they could be, evne to someone that shows up on time, even early, to class at the academy. "Yes Master Mao." "Good. I want those two as subjects in my Hollow tests. Yes, we can perfect Hollowization technique! *Huff huff* Just imagine if I can make the process safe and reversible! I need to find out if the ressurective immortality Primes have will restore them to their original bodies after death. I need subject material that are demons to ensure the test is accurate as possible! Now, let's go!"
